About Dudhiasul Village
Dudhiasul is a village in Chandua tehsil in district of Mayurbhanj, Odisha,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Dudhiasul was 822 which includes 422 males and 400 females. Dudhiasul covers 132 ha area. Pincode of Dudhiasul is 757081.
